Liverpool confirm UK pre-season games against Tranmere, Fleetwood, Wigan & Huddersfield

Liverpool have today announced four UK friendlies that will take place this July to kick-off the Reds pre-season programme before they head to America.

· Tranmere Rovers v LFC, Friday 8 July, Kick-off 7pm BST
· Fleetwood Town v LFC, Wednesday 13 July, Kick-off 7pm BST
· Wigan Athletic v LFC, Sunday 17 July, Kick-off 4pm BST
· Huddersfield Town v LFC, Wednesday 20 July, Kick-off 7.45pm BST

The Reds at Tranmere Rovers, who they last faced in a pre-season friendly in 2009.

Moving further north for the clash with Lancashire-side Fleetwood Town – the Reds last came across the Cod Army for a friendly in 2003.

Wigan Athletic will host Liverpool at the DW Stadium – the two teams have not met since their 2013 Premier League clash when the Reds won 4-0 with Luis Suarez scoring a hat-trick.

To round off the four UK pre-season friendlies before heading to America, the team will head to West Yorkshire for an evening kick off with Huddersfield Town at the John Smith’s Stadium – the first time the teams have met since the FA Cup third round in 1999.

The fixtures show a clear sign that Jurgen Klopp has had a say in the Reds’ pre-season plans, with a far more low key approach than in previous years.

LFC will continue their summer training in California, where they’ll be based in Palo Alto, training at Stanford university. They will compete in the International Champions Cup against Chelsea and AC Milan, then back to London to face Barcelona at Wembley.
